    optimization, materia, and the like only matter if you're dying to enrage constantly, not if you're failing mechanics. their priorities were way out of sync with what the group needed to succeed. for example, our leader left the decision to use Pot's during prog up to YOU until we hit enrage. Once we hit enrage, Pots were enforced. the idea was to get everyone to focus on mechanics first then go for bigger numbers later, unless you wanted to do both at once (which most of them did anyway).
